Jezzball Classic Deluxe Edition
Single-player alternative to Absorber: Absorb Adapt Survive — playable solo, no multiplayer required. Shares Indie with Absorber: Absorb Adapt Survive.
In JezzBall, your goal is to contain bouncing Jezz atoms by building walls. Complete levels by converting over 75% of the chamber into walls, adding a new atom each time. Left-click to deploy walls and right-click for direction.
